Hermeus has stolen another quick march on its way to building a hypersonic aircraft as it begins testing its proprietary precooler on a Pratt & Whitney F100 jet engine that will be installed in the company's Quarterhorse Mk 2 prototype.Continue ReadingCategory: Aircraft, TransportTags: Hypersonic, Hermeus, Aircraft, Flight, Flight Tests

wim delvoye questions ‘the order of things’ Wim Delvoye’s sculptures find a new home and new perceptions within the storied walls of Geneva’s Museum of Art and History, inviting an eclectic play of reflections and contrasts. The museum’s fourth Carte Blanche XL exhibition, The Order of Things, proposes a playful abundance of objects, references, […]
